# Suspended Listings, Mercari

> Suspended Listings for Mercari stores. Tracked live in Vortex IQ Nerve Centre. How to read it, why it matters, and how to act on it.

**Card class:** [Hero](/nerve-centre/overview#card-classes-explained)  •  **Category:** [Marketplace](/nerve-centre/connectors#connectors-by-type)

## At a glance

> **Suspended Listings** is the current count of listings Mercari has taken down for prohibited items, intellectual property infringement, or other policy violations. Every suspended listing is lost sales today and a strike against your seller standing tomorrow.

## Calculation

Vortex IQ reads the status of each listing from the Mercari API and counts those Mercari has marked suspended at the moment of the refresh. Because the window is real time, the card reflects the current standing of your catalogue rather than a historical tally. A listing leaves the count once you correct the violation and Mercari reinstates it, or once you delete it.

## Worked example

*A representative reading of **Suspended Listings** for a typical Mercari reseller.* On the morning of 19 Mar 26 the card jumps from 0 to 4. Opening the detail, three of the four are branded handbags flagged for IP infringement, and the fourth is a fragrance flagged as a prohibited item. The reading tells you Mercari has pulled these from sale and that your account now carries four fresh policy actions. The action is immediate: review each flag, remove the listings that genuinely breach policy so you do not re-trigger the same suspension, and appeal any you believe are wrong with proof of authenticity. ## Reconciling against Mercari

**Where to look in Mercari's own dashboard:**

In your Mercari seller account, suspended items surface under your listings view with a status badge and, usually, a notification explaining the policy reason. The card aggregates these into one live count so you do not have to scroll your whole catalogue to find them. Mercari's notifications and your listing statuses are the source of truth for the reason behind each suspension.

**Why the Vortex IQ value may legitimately differ:**

| Reason                                                                                                                      | Direction | What to do               |
| --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| --------- | ------------------------ |
| **Period boundary.** A suspension applied or lifted between refreshes may briefly differ from what you see live in Mercari. | Variable  | Match the period range.  |
| **Time zone.** Action timestamps may be recorded in a different zone to your dashboard.                                     | Marginal  | Confirm time zone match. |
| **Filter scope.** The card counts platform suspensions, not listings you have paused or deleted yourself.                   | Variable  | Match filter settings.   |

## Known limitations / merchant FAQs

**Q: How often does Suspended Listings update?**
It is a real-time card, so it reflects the suspended count read from the Mercari API at each standard data refresh. New suspensions appear and reinstated items drop off on the next refresh.

**Q: Why does my Mercari dashboard show a different number?**
Differences usually come from timing, where a suspension is applied or lifted between refreshes, or from counting only Mercari's policy actions rather than listings you paused or deleted yourself.

**Q: Does this card explain why a listing was suspended?**
The card gives you the count and the affected listings; the specific policy reason comes from Mercari's notification on each listing. Vortex Mind can group suspensions by likely cause to speed up your review.
